Humor and creativity are deeply connected, with research showing that laughter and a playful mindset can enhance problem-solving by encouraging free association and flexible thinking. Techniques for Creative Humor
Embrace Playfulness: Adopting a “childish inclination for play” can unlock new ways to view problems.
Connect Unrelated Ideas: Creativity often stems from linking disparate concepts. Improvisational humor specifically helps train your brain to make these unexpected connections.
Practice Daily: Actively writing jokes or brainstorming silly scenarios daily can increase the speed and quality of your wit.
Create a Light Atmosphere: Working in a fun environment, rather than a tense one, makes “aha” moments—often prompted by “haha” moments—more likely. Why Humor Boosts Creativity
Broadened Perspective: Humor helps break linear thinking, allowing for unconventional solutions.
Mental Spaciousness: Laughter creates a relaxed state that aids in associative thinking, similar to the benefits of taking a walk or a nap.
